Key Featrues

12-Bit Resolution: The LTC1860 offers a 12-bit resolution, providing precise and accurate analog-to-digital conversion. This high resolution ensures detailed signal representation, making it ideal for applications requiring high fidelity, such as high-speed data acquisition and precision instrumentation.
250ksps Sampling Rate: With a sampling rate of 250k samples per second, the LTC1860 is capable of capturing fast-changing signals with minimal aliasing. This feature is critical for applications like portable instrumentation and remote data acquisition, where rapid signal processing is essential.
Low Power Consumption: The LTC1860 operates with a low supply current of 850µA and automatically powers down to 1nA between conversions. This makes it highly efficient for battery-operated or low-power devices, extending battery life and reducing energy costs.
SPI/MICROWIRE™ Compatible Serial I/O: The LTC1860 features a serial interface compatible with SPI and MICROWIRE™ protocols, enabling easy integration with microcontrollers and digital systems. This simplifies design and reduces the need for additional components, enhancing system efficiency.
True Differential Inputs: The LTC1860 supports true differential inputs, allowing for accurate signal acquisition in noisy environments. This feature improves signal integrity and reduces common-mode noise, making it suitable for isolated or remote data acquisition systems.

Applications

High-Speed Data Acquisition Systems: The LTC1860/LTC1861 is perfect for high-speed data acquisition systems requiring precise and fast analog-to-digital conversion. Its 12-bit resolution and 250ksps sampling rate make it ideal for capturing rapid signal changes in applications like oscilloscopes, medical imaging, and radar systems, ensuring accurate data capture in real-time.
Portable Instrumentation: With its low power consumption and compact MSOP package, the LTC1860/LTC1861 is well-suited for portable or compact instrumentation. Its auto-shutdown feature reduces supply current to 2µA at lower sampling rates, making it ideal for battery-operated devices such as handheld multimeters, environmental monitors, and portable medical devices.
Remote Data Acquisition: The LTC1860/LTC1861 is an excellent choice for isolated or remote data acquisition systems. Its differential input capability and external reference support enable accurate measurements in harsh environments, such as industrial automation, remote sensing, and telemetry systems, where signal integrity is critical.
Precision Sensor Interfaces: The LTC1860/LTC1861 can be used as a precision sensor interface for applications requiring high-accuracy analog-to-digital conversion. Its true differential inputs and low noise performance make it suitable for interfacing with sensors like load cells, pressure sensors, and temperature sensors in industrial control systems and laboratory equipment.
